About Hiring a Lawyer in Indonesia

Hiring a lawyer in Indonesia involves several key steps to ensure you find a qualified professional to suit your legal needs. Initially, you should identify the specific area of law that pertains to your case, as this will guide you in selecting a specialist. Word-of-mouth recommendations, online reviews, and official directories can be useful in finding reputable lawyers. It is advisable to verify the lawyer's credentials and membership with the Indonesian Advocates Association (PERADI) or equivalent professional bodies. Once you've made a choice, a formal agreement detailing the scope of work, fees, and payment terms should be agreed upon before proceeding with legal services.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

There are numerous situations in Indonesia where seeking legal assistance may be crucial. For personal matters, this could include divorce proceedings, child custody disputes, or estate inheritance issues. In business, you might need legal counsel for contract negotiations, compliance with local business regulations, or resolving commercial disputes. Additionally, legal representation is advisable if you face criminal charges or need to settle land or property disputes. Lawyers can also offer invaluable assistance in navigating Indonesia's bureaucratic hurdles and in ensuring that all legal documents are correctly drafted and filed.

Local Laws Overview

Indonesia's legal system is a mix of civil law, customary law (Adat), and the influence of Islamic law. Key legal areas include the Indonesian Civil Code, which governs civil matters such as contracts and family law. Company law is regulated by the Company Law no. 40 of 2007, while commercial transactions are often subject to the Commercial Code. Labor laws are comprehensive, with regulations set forth by the Manpower Act, addressing employment terms, employee rights, and dispute settlement. Understanding these evolving legal frameworks is crucial for lawyers practicing in Indonesia, especially when dealing with foreign clients or cross-border issues.

Frequently Asked Questions

What qualifications should a lawyer have in Indonesia?

A lawyer in Indonesia should have a law degree, pass the bar examination, and be licensed by the Indonesian Advocates Association (PERADI).

How do I verify a lawyer’s credentials?

You can verify a lawyer's credentials by checking their membership with PERADI or other recognized legal associations and seek reviews or testimonials from previous clients.

Is it common for lawyers to specialize in specific areas of law?

Yes, many lawyers in Indonesia specialize in specific areas such as corporate law, family law, criminal defense, or intellectual property to offer expert advice and representation.

What is the average cost of hiring a lawyer in Indonesia?

The cost varies greatly depending on the lawyer's experience, specialization, and the complexity of the case. Some lawyers charge hourly rates, while others might offer fixed fees for certain services.

Can I find English-speaking lawyers in Indonesia?

Yes, especially in larger cities like Jakarta and Bali, many law firms offer services with English-speaking lawyers to accommodate international clients.

Are there free legal services available in Indonesia?

Some non-profit organizations and university legal clinics offer free legal aid to those who qualify. Additionally, you might find pro bono services from lawyers in certain cases.

How long does it typically take to resolve a legal case in Indonesia?

The duration varies widely, with complex cases potentially taking years, while more straightforward matters could be resolved in a few months.

What if I am not satisfied with my lawyer's service?

If unsatisfied, you should first address your concerns with your lawyer. If unresolved, you may lodge a complaint with the Indonesian Bar Association or seek another legal opinion.

How do lawyers stay updated on the latest laws in Indonesia?

Lawyers in Indonesia often participate in continuous legal education, workshops, and subscribe to legal publications to stay informed about the latest laws and regulations.

Do lawyers in Indonesia handle international cases?

Yes, several law firms specialize in international law, particularly in sectors like trade, finance, and human rights, to handle cross-border legal matters.

Additional Resources

For additional legal assistance, consider reaching out to the Indonesian Advocates Association (PERADI), the Ministry of Law and Human Rights, or legal aid organizations like LBH Jakarta. Law faculties at Indonesian universities also frequently offer resources and advice through their legal aid bodies.
